Is rice a suitable crop where water is scarce? What role should government play when over-irrigation threatens to degrade an environment? How can the competing demands of conservationists, farmers, livestock owners and hydroelectricity managers in Tanzania all be satisfied?
A University of East Anglia School of Development Studies report examines rice cultivation in the Usangu wetland of southern Tanzania. This complicated hydrological environment has relevance for other river basins where scarce water supplies have to be allocated to different groups of people.
A key feature of the Usangu wetland is the expansion and contraction both of the perennial swamp and the seasonally flooded wetland. The project for the Sustainable Management of the Usangu Wetlands and its Catchment (SMUWC) operates within the framework of a World Bank river basin management initiative, which grew from concern at the impact of reduced water flows on hydropower generation.
Government policy has been shaped by non-scientific misconceptions. SMUWC has not only had to nail down the real reasons for the absence of sufficient water but also to address untenable politically-generated conclusions.
